[Bf-blender-cvs] SVN commit: /data/svn/bf-blender [57056] trunk/blender/intern/cycles: Cycles / OpenCL:

Thomas Dinges blender at dingto.org
Mon May 27 19:13:36 CEST 2013


Revision: 57056
          http://projects.blender.org/scm/viewvc.php?view=rev&root=bf-blender&revision=57056
Author:   dingto
Date:     2013-05-27 17:13:36 +0000 (Mon, 27 May 2013)
Log Message:
-----------
Cycles / OpenCL:
* Use advanced shading for nvidia as well, works fine on my Geforce 540M with sm_21. 
I tested the files from regression suite. 

Modified Paths:
--------------
    trunk/blender/intern/cycles/device/device_opencl.cpp
    trunk/blender/intern/cycles/kernel/kernel_types.h

Modified: trunk/blender/intern/cycles/device/device_opencl.cpp
===================================================================
--- trunk/blender/intern/cycles/device/device_opencl.cpp	2013-05-27 17:11:05 UTC (rev 57055)
+++ trunk/blender/intern/cycles/device/device_opencl.cpp	2013-05-27 17:13:36 UTC (rev 57056)
@@ -69,7 +69,7 @@
 {
 	/* keep this in sync with kernel_types.h! */
 	if(platform == "NVIDIA CUDA")
-		return false;
+		return true;
 	else if(platform == "Apple")
 		return false;
 	else if(platform == "AMD Accelerated Parallel Processing")

Modified: trunk/blender/intern/cycles/kernel/kernel_types.h
===================================================================
--- trunk/blender/intern/cycles/kernel/kernel_types.h	2013-05-27 17:11:05 UTC (rev 57055)
+++ trunk/blender/intern/cycles/kernel/kernel_types.h	2013-05-27 17:13:36 UTC (rev 57056)
@@ -70,7 +70,7 @@
 
 #ifdef __KERNEL_OPENCL_NVIDIA__
 #define __KERNEL_SHADING__
-//#define __KERNEL_ADV_SHADING__
+#define __KERNEL_ADV_SHADING__
 #endif
 
 #ifdef __KERNEL_OPENCL_APPLE__




More information about the Bf-blender-cvs mailing list